Dr. Kerstin Bäcker takes part in a panel discussion on AI, responsibility and the question of authorship at MEDIENTAGE MÜNCHEN – the leading industry gathering in Europe.

Artificial Intelligence
Friday, 27 October 2023
12:10 – 12:30

Green Stage
